What is the best time to visit Sairme, Imereti?
The best time to visit Sairme is from late spring to early autumn (May to September) when the weather is pleasant and the natural surroundings are at their most beautiful.
How do I get to Sairme from Tbilisi?
You can reach Sairme from Tbilisi by car, which takes about 3.5 to 4 hours. Alternatively, you can take a train or bus to Kutaisi and then a taxi or local transport to Sairme.
What are the main attractions in Sairme?
Sairme is famous for its mineral waters and spa resorts. The main attractions include the Sairme Mineral Water Park, the spa and wellness centers, and the beautiful surrounding nature, perfect for hiking and relaxation.
Are there any specific health benefits associated with Sairme's mineral waters?
Yes, Sairme's mineral waters are known for their therapeutic properties, particularly for digestive and metabolic disorders. Many visitors come to Sairme for health treatments and wellness retreats.

Are there any local customs or etiquette I should be aware of?
Georgians are known for their hospitality. It's polite to greet people with a smile and a friendly 'Gamarjoba' (hello). When visiting religious sites, dress modestly and respectfully.

What kind of food can I expect in Sairme?
You can enjoy traditional Georgian cuisine in Sairme, including dishes like khachapuri (cheese bread), khinkali (dumplings), and various grilled meats and fresh salads. Many hotels and restaurants offer a mix of local and international dishes.
